Currency and Payment Methods: Convenience is Key
Dealing with currency conversions and unfamiliar payment methods can be a major inconvenience. A well-localised casino will:
- Accept Euro (EUR): This is the most basic requirement. Avoid casinos that only offer currency conversions, as this can lead to unnecessary fees and complications.
- Offer Popular Irish Payment Methods: Look for casinos that support payment methods commonly used in Ireland, such as debit cards, credit cards, e-wallets like PayPal, and potentially even direct bank transfers.
- Transparent Fees and Limits: All fees associated with deposits and withdrawals should be clearly displayed, along with any applicable limits.

- Responsible Gambling Tools: A commitment to responsible gambling is crucial. Look for casinos that offer de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and links to support organisations like Problem Gambling Ireland.
